  • ICT Price Action Chronicles – Market On Close Macro

    ICT Price Action Chronicles – Market On Close Macro

    https://www.youtube.com/watch?v=PP1-i0ti_tQ

    This is a trading lesson using the August 3, 2026 New York PM session to teach a short, repeatable intraday “market-on-close” (aka “murder on close”) scalping macro that often produces clean, predictable price runs in the last hour of regular trading. Key timing rules: set your clock to New York local time; the NY PM pre-session begins at 1:30 PM ET, 3:00 PM often produces a defining premium wick (PDA) and 3:50–4:00 PM is the critical 10-minute market-on-close window to watch. Method highlights: identify the last-hour high/low range, grade any wicks (wicks take precedence over adjacent fair-value gaps), spot relative equal highs/lows and minor sell-side/buy-side liquidity pools, then project the first-octant/0.5 fib level as a high-probability target (example target shown ~28,870.75). Risk and execution: anchor stop-losses near the 3:00 premium-wick high (upper-half context), allow measured drawdown into the wick, add to positions on expected tests, and use partials rather than obsessing over perfect exits. Trade psychology and process: expect losses and missed trades, backtest the rules, practice disciplined entries/management, and refine execution over time rather than chasing perfection.

  • Part 2 High Precision Secrets To Intraday Price Action

    Part 2 High Precision Secrets To Intraday Price Action

    https://www.youtube.com/watch?v=BD7kqmgdBU8

    Summary:

    – The speaker (34 years trading) emphasizes studying how markets form highs/lows and session structure by logging, backtesting and learning the underlying mechanics rather than relying on pundits or simplified “systems.”
    – Primary framework: use the daily chart as the source for high/low/range information, then grade that range by time (opening range, first hour, PD arrays, octants/quadrants) and price (fair value gaps, order blocks, volume imbalances).
    – Practical setup explained in detail: measure the opening range gap (e.g., 9:30 open vs prior settlement at 4:14), identify consequent encroachment (half-gap), fair value/inversion gaps, and PD arrays to predict likely reactions and targets.
    – Trade rules and money management: prefer low-hanging objectives first (half-gap), take partials (e.g., partial at half-gap, bulk at full gap closure), leave a runner, pyramid into drawdown if able, place stops above consequential levels, and use micro contracts if volatility makes larger stops impractical.
    – Targets and extensions: plan exits at half-gap, full gap, negative0.2, negative0.5, and 1.0 standard deviation levels; roll stops up as trades progress to protect profits.
    – Philosophy: this is a technical, time-and-price science — not pattern superstition. It requires disciplined study and cannot be meaningfully shortcuted; laziness produces weak, short-lived results.

  • Part 1 \ High Precision Secrets To Intraday Price Action

    Part 1 \ High Precision Secrets To Intraday Price Action

    https://www.youtube.com/watch?v=DRTvbkKmuAw

    – Opening remarks and brief apology for a distracted recording; personal anecdote about family and a live-stream discussion.
    – Core trading idea: focus on a specific, finite pre-market time range (pre-session 7:00–9:00 a.m. ET). Treat that window as the primary data sample for the regular session.
    – Methodology: anchor a Fibonacci to the highest high and lowest low inside the 7–9 a.m. range, then project precise horizontal price levels (quadrants/octants, midpoints) forward as key reference points.
    – Key price-structure concepts used: buy-side imbalances / sell-side inefficiencies, inversion fair value gaps, breakaway gaps, consequent encroachment — all tethered to specific candles and the time-based range.
    – Practical rule: levels must be precise and time-anchored (not vague “zones”); trades are anticipatory (based on those specific levels and the 9:01+ behavior), not reactive.
    – Example: he publicly identified and shorted the daily high in a recent session, targeted ~28,400, and the market reached the projected area—used to demonstrate the method’s predictive value.
    – Broader approach: use the last 3 days for intraday low/high projections; combine daily and intraday references (wicks, opening gaps) to refine targets.

  • Chain Of Custody Of Price With RTH ORG

    Chain Of Custody Of Price With RTH ORG

    https://www.youtube.com/watch?v=V5crdCw0AsY

    Summary:

    The speaker explains the “chain of custody for price”—how price moves between high-probability PD (price discovery) arrays—by using visual, mathematical tools rather than retail myths (support/resistance, generic supply/demand). Core concepts:

    – Markets are algorithmic and autonomous; short disruptions happen, but price delivery follows structural imbalances.
    – Identify and grade inefficiencies (buy-side imbalances, sell-side inefficiencies, suspension blocks) on higher timeframes (daily/weekly). Grading creates octant/quadrant/gradient levels to guide lower-timeframe analysis.
    – Use the regular trading hours opening-range gap (OR gap) as a precise intraday reference (anchor Fib to the higher of the 9:30 candlestick open/close and use the prior session’s final print for the low). Map octant/quadrant levels inside that graded gap.
    – Spot fair value gaps (FVGs): the three-candle pattern where candle two creates the gap. Note first-utilization FVGs (direction of original use) and inversion FVGs (when price later trades through and reverses their logic).
    – A breakaway gap (inefficiency around the midpoint of your analysis that never trades back into) signals strong continuation in that direction.
    – Trade higher-probability setups where time, price, your directional bias, and multiple PD arrays/graded levels agree—more overlapping signals mean a greater likelihood price moves as expected.

    Bottom line: grade inefficiencies, align timeframes and OR gap octant/quadrant levels, watch FVG behavior and overlaps of PD arrays; when multiple tools agree, you get higher-probability price movement.

  • TRU Mentorship Sunday – Chain of Custody | July 26, 2026

    Summary — Monday mentorship on “chain of custody” (mapping unrealized dealing ranges)

    Purpose

    • The session explains how to identify, grade and trade unrealized dealing ranges (PD arrays) — i.e., where price is likely to run to and where intra-day PD arrays (order blocks, fair value gaps, breakers, etc.) should form. The method uses time-based session anchors, octants/quadrants on a fib, and PD-array validation to distinguish retracements from reversals.

    Key practical rules and workflows

    • Anchor your intraday canvas to clear, time-based reference points: previous month/week/day highs & lows, last three days’ high/low, and session highs/lows (e.g., midnight ET opening price and 2:00 AM ET for the London window).
    • For London trading specifically (trading 3:00 AM London session; 2:00–5:00 AM ET): use the range from midnight ET open to the low formed before 2:00 AM ET. If a CB/SIBI exists there, anchor your fib to the high of the relevant CB (number-two candle) and draw to the low of that two‑hour range. Grade the range with octants/quadrants and wait for PD arrays to form at those levels.
    • If you trade only London and plan to be done before NY open, aim modest targets (e.g., 25–30 handles on Nasdaq CFD) and accept you won’t capture multi-session daily range.
    • When using new‑day/new‑week opening gaps or registered opening range gaps, require agreement (inefficiencies both above and below price) and use them as additional anchors for grading and stacking PD arrays.

    Order flow & PD-array validation

    • True continuation setups form predictable PD arrays at octant/quadrant levels; if price consistently fails those levels or tears through non‑anchored FVGs/blocks, expect consolidation or a reversal.
    • Practical signals: how candles trade into/around prior candle bodies/wicks, relationships of body-to-wick, and whether fair value gaps remain unfilled or are aggressively taken out — these are the real order-flow clues.
    • Speed and how many PD arrays are invalidated matter: knocking off three PD arrays tends to indicate a reversal; fewer may be a retracement.

    Volume imbalances, suspension blocks & stops

    • When toggling settled/unsettled imbalances, use the more prominent (larger) volume imbalance as your reference — it’s less likely to be invalidated by noise.
    • For a suspension block formed by a 3-bar pattern, identify the three reference PD-array levels (lower imbalance high, midpoint/consequent-encroachment, and the upper imbalance high) to define bias/stops and invalidation points.

    CFD vs futures guidance

    • If you trade CFDs outside the U.S., analyze the equivalent futures contract for cleaner structure and use that for bias; map those levels to your CFD chart at the same candle/time. Expect CFDs to underperform the futures’ ultimate range, so scale targets down (take partial profits earlier).

    Practice advice

    • Spend time backtesting and studying the grading concept across sessions and higher timeframes. Start with the simple rule set (session highs/lows, prev day/week/month, last three days), learn to recognize PD-array formation around octants/quadrants, then build to more complex gap & mitigation flow ideas.
    • The methodology rewards patience and pattern recognition rather than guesswork — grade the canvas and wait for PD arrays to validate the bias.
